Supply and demand tight in the first half, demand expected to increase in the future

With demand for diborane (B2H6, diborane) tight and expectations for increased demand, and as it is being discussed as a candidate material for new processes, a boom in new construction and expansion is taking place in Korea.
According to the semiconductor specialty gas industry, it has been reported that at least four domestic companies have recently entered the market for diborane (B2H6).
Diboran experienced supply and demand instability in the first half of the year due to increased factory utilization rates of semiconductor makers and limited supply from diboran producers.
Domestically, the product is supplied by companies such as Matheson Specialty Gases Korea, Air Liquide Solutions Korea, Versum Materials Korea, and Wonik Materials, and inventory levels were so tight that it sold out immediately upon production.
Diboran has maintained a balance of supply and demand by supplying according to the needs of major semiconductor companies, including domestic firms like Samsung Electronics and SK Hynix as well as the U.S. company Micron; however, demand has recently increased as the semiconductor industry's operating rates have risen amidst a global semiconductor shortage.
Diborane is a key gas used in semiconductor and solar doping processes and is used as an in-situ doping material in various semiconductor blanket and stacking deposition processes. While arsine and phosphine are mainly used in n-type semiconductors, diborane is widely used in p-type semiconductors.
On the other hand, the semiconductor industry reported that diborane is highly likely to be used in other processes in the future, in addition to the doping process. Although the exact process has not been disclosed, it is being discussed as a material to be used in the new process.
Consequently, the market for Diboran is currently tight, and it is predicted that the shortage will continue in the future.
Accordingly, the industry anticipates that demand for Diboran will be two to three times higher than current levels, and it is reported that they are proceeding with expansion and new investments.
Meanwhile, diborane (B2H6) is a type of boran that is a colorless gas with a peculiar odor and is a highly toxic substance. It can be fatal if inhaled and can cause burns, so caution must be exercised when handling it.
